What are the five broad categories that describe the way in which nominations are made?

There are five methods of nomination for a Presidential candidate. These methods are self announcement, petition, caucus, direct primary, and convention.


How to conduct a successful market research study in 5 steps?

To conduct a successful market research study in 5 steps, first define your objectives and target audience. Next, choose the appropriate research methods such as surveys or focus groups. Then, collect and analyze the data gathered. After that, draw conclusions and make recommendations based on the findings. Finally, present your findings in a clear and concise manner to stakeholders.

Types of education research?

Generally there are three types of research design: quantitative design, qualitative design, and mixed methods design.Quantitative Research Design:Measured and express in terms of quantity. Expression of a property or quantity in numerical terms. Quantitative Research Design helps in precise measurement, knowing trends or changes overtime, comparing trends.Qualitative Research Design:Involves quality or kind, helps in having insight into problem or cases.Mixed Research Design: The type of research in which a research or team of researchers combines elements of qualitative and quantitative research approaches (e.g., use of qualitative and quantitative viewpoints, data collections, analysis, inference techniques) for the broad purposes of breadth and depth of understanding and corroboration.
